JPS RENEWABLE ENERGY PARTNERS WITH ELLENOR TO INSTALL SOLAR ARRAY SYSTEM

by | Oct 3, 2024 | Dartford Charities

JPS Renewable Energy, a leading provider of solar panel and battery storage installation service in the UK, is proud to announce the installation of a cutting-edge solar array system for ellenor, a renowned provider of hospice care with an inpatient ward and community-based services in Gravesend. This partnership represents a significant step towards sustainability and energy efficiency for the hospice, while also supporting the care facility’s commitment to environmental responsibility.

The solar array system, expertly designed and installed by JPS Renewable Energy, will provide a substantial portion of the hospice’s energy needs, reducing its carbon footprint and energy costs. This clean energy solution will enable ellenor Hospice to allocate more resources to its vital work, offering palliative and end-of-life care to families in Kent and Bexley.

A Commitment to Sustainability and Care

The solar installation, which consists of 120 JA Solar Panels with a system size of 52.8kW generating 54,780kWh per year of renewable Energy, will harness the power of the sun to generate renewable energy, significantly reducing the hospice’s dependence on non-renewable energy sources. This initiative is aligned with ellenor’s ongoing efforts to reduce operational costs and environmental impact, while continuing to provide compassionate care to patients and their families.

Richard Cromarty, Managing Director of JPS Renewable Energy, commented on the project: “We are thrilled to collaborate with ellenor in bringing sustainable energy solutions to such an important institution in our community. By helping ellenor lower their energy costs, we hope to contribute to their ability to continue delivering exceptional care, while also promoting renewable energy use.”

ellenor, which has been providing care since 1985, is equally excited about the partnership.

Since 1985, ellenor has been providing compassionate palliative care, wellbeing services, and end-of-life care for local people living within Dartford, Gravesham, Swanley, and Bexley and is equally excited about this partnership.

Liam Stone, Director of Operations at ellenor Hospice, said:

“As part of our strategic growth for the charity, our ambition is to reduce our carbon footprint by 30% over the next three years. This solar array installation is a game-changer for us. Not only will it help us save on energy costs, but it also reflects our commitment to being environmentally responsible as we continue to care for our patients and their families. We are grateful to JPS Renewable Energy for their expertise and generosity in making this happen.”
